Lowering thick plants is a important element of landscape management, helping to restore order, enhance looks,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can limit airflow, minimize sunlight penetration, and develop chances for bugs and illness. Pruning and thinning are the main approaches for managing dense or rowdy plants, enabling plants to flourish while preserving a controlled look. The process includes selectively removing excess branches, stems, and foliage, always thinking about the natural growth routine of each species. Timing is essential; some plants react best to pruning throughout dormancy, while blooming ranges may require post-bloom cutting to protect blooms. Correct method guarantees cuts are clean and positioned to encourage healthy brand-new growth. In addition to enhancing plant health, minimizing overgrowth improves ease of access and exposure in the landscape Paths, driveways, and outdoor living spaces end up being safer and more inviting. Long-lasting maintenance plans avoid future overgrowth, ensuring a well balanced and unified landscape.
